javascript实现根据身份证号码识别性别和年龄

免费源码 2025-05-15 05:08www.dzhlxh.cn免费源码

旨在分享如何使用JavaScript根据身份证号码识别性别和年龄。通过简单的HTML页面,用户可以输入身份证号码,然后点击按钮获取相关信息。

让我们来看一下这个HTML页面的设计。页面包含两个输入框,一个用于输入身份证号码,另一个是一个按钮,用于触发识别性别和年龄的功能。整个页面的设计简洁明了,用户友好。

在JavaScript部分,我们定义了一个名为`discriCard`的函数,它接受一个参数,即用户的身份证号码。这个函数首先根据身份证号码获取性别和出生日期信息。然后,通过比较当前日期和出生日期,计算出用户的年龄。

关于性别的识别,函数通过检查身份证号码的第17位(奇数为男,偶数为女)来确定性别。如果第17位是奇数,那么弹出的警告框会显示“男”,反之则显示“女”。

接下来是年龄的计算。函数首先获取当前年份,然后减去身份证上的出生年份,得出初步的年龄。然后,通过比较身份证上的月份和日期与当前日期,进行必要的调整。如果身份证上的生日还未到,那么年龄需要减一。

整个函数的设计逻辑清晰,易于理解。用户只需在输入框中输入身份证号码,然后点击按钮,就能获取性别和年龄信息。这对于需要快速识别身份证信息的应用场景非常实用。

这篇文章提供了使用JavaScript识别身份证信息的一个简单实例。它不仅有助于读者理解如何使用JavaScript处理字符串和日期,还展示了如何设计用户友好的网页应用。希望这篇文章对大家学习JavaScript程序设计有所帮助。

Copyright © 2016-2025 www.dzhlxh.cn 金源码 版权所有 Power by

网站模板下载|网络推广|微博营销|seo优化|视频营销|网络营销|微信营销|网站建设|织梦模板|小程序模板